What Does a Hard or Soft Belly Mean for Your Health?

The stomach area is one of the most important parts of our body, and its appearance can sometimes indicate our overall health. There are two main types of belly – a hard belly and a soft belly.

Understanding the differences between them can help you determine if there are health issues that need to be addressed. In this article, we will explore the meaning behind a hard or soft belly and what they can tell us about our health.

What is a hard belly?

A hard belly is one that is firm to the touch, has little or no give when pressed or squeezed, and appears to be distended or protruded. There are several reasons why someone may have a hard belly, including:.

Poor dietary habits

Eating a diet that is high in processed foods, refined sugar, and unhealthy fats can cause the body to store excess fat in the stomach area. This can cause the belly to become swollen and hard to the touch.

Constipation or bloating

When the digestive system is not functioning properly, waste material can accumulate in the colon and cause the area to become swollen and hard.

This can be caused by a diet that is low in fiber, consuming too much dairy or gluten, or not drinking enough water.

Excess gas

Often caused by eating too quickly or consuming foods that are difficult to digest, excess gas can cause the stomach to become swollen and hard to the touch.

Liver disease

When the liver is not functioning properly, it can cause the abdomen to become swollen and hard.

This is because the liver is responsible for breaking down and filtering toxins from the body, and when it is unable to do so, the body can become swollen and inflamed.

What is a soft belly?

A soft belly is one that is pliable and easy to the touch. It does not appear swollen or distended and is generally considered a sign of good health. There can be several reasons why someone may have a soft belly, including:.

A healthy diet

Eating a balanced diet that is rich in whole foods, fruits, and vegetables can prevent excess fat storage in the stomach area, resulting in a soft and healthy belly.

Exercise

Regular exercise, especially cardio and strength training, can reduce the amount of fat stored in the abdomen, resulting in a soft and toned belly.

Good digestive health

A healthy digestive system can prevent constipation, bloating, and excess gas, resulting in a soft and healthy belly.

Eating a diet that is high in fiber, drinking plenty of water, and avoiding foods that irritate the digestive system can all contribute to good digestive health.

Conclusion

The appearance of your belly can tell you a lot about your overall health. A hard belly can be a sign of poor dietary habits, constipation, bloating, excess gas, or liver disease.

A soft belly, on the other hand, can be a sign of a healthy diet, regular exercise, and good digestive health. If you have concerns about the appearance of your belly or other health issues, it is important to talk to your doctor.
